Why This Hook Works
This hook leverages the psychological mechanism of the curiosity gap, which creates an immediate urge to know more. When the audience hears 'the one styling mistake,' they instinctively want to discover what this mistake is, leading to increased engagement as they click to find out. The phrase 'are you guilty?' adds a layer of self-reflection, prompting viewers to analyze their own practices. This not only piques their interest but also makes them feel personally addressed, further enhancing their connection to the content.
Additionally, this hook uses a pattern interrupt by contrasting the common expectation of straightforward styling tips with a provocative question about mistakes. This interruption in the norm captures attention and compels viewers to stop scrolling. It also plays on the fear of missing out (FOMO); audiences may worry that they are unwittingly making a mistake that could hinder their engagement rates, pushing them to seek answers immediately.
Moreover, this hook aligns well with the fashion niche, where the audience is often looking for ways to improve their content and engagement. By framing the message around a 'mistake,' it subtly suggests that improvement is possible, tapping into the aspirational mindset of creators who want to elevate their brand. This combination of curiosity, urgency, and personal reflection creates a compelling reason for viewers to engage with the content.
This hook performs best on platforms like Instagram Reels and TikTok, particularly within the fashion niche, where visual engagement and quick, impactful messages are key.
